    Information / Baghdad..
    The economic expert, Nabil Al-Ali, considered, on Tuesday, hosting Oil Minister Ihsan Abdul-Jabbar in the Parliamentary Oil and Energy Committee, a correct oversight measure regarding the oil pipeline project between Iraq and Jordan, which extends from Basra to the port of Aqaba, indicating that the project has no feasibility or An economic benefit for Iraq and that it serves Jordan only.

Al-Ali said in a statement to / the information /, that "the draft agreement to build an oil pipeline from Basra to the Jordanian port of Aqaba does not have any feasibility or economic benefit for Iraq and that it serves Jordan only." . He stressed that “the project is political because it will pay the Hashemite Kingdom of Jordan Iraqi oil at low prices that I don’t remember and at the expense of the Iraqi people.”
    He added that “hosting Oil Minister Ihsan Abdul-Jabbar in the Parliamentary Oil and Energy Committee is a correct oversight procedure and praises him for its discussion and asking him to present the economic feasibility on paper.”
